如果,系统中没有安装jdk,详见《1.Ubuntu16.04一键安装jdk》进行相关jdk的安装配置。
【软件版本说明】
软件名 | 版本号 |
---|---|
jdk | 1.8.121 |
maven | 3.5 |
1.一键安装jdk脚本
#!/bin/bash
#this shell to use installing maven3.5
echo "this shell to use installing and maven3.5"
echo "------------------start to install jdk----------------------"
#sudo su #切换到root权限
echo "------------------------------------------------------------"
echo "------------------start to install maven--------------------"
mkdir /usr/local/maven3
cd /usr/local/maven3
#download maven 3.5.0
wget https://coding.net/u/jamesz2011/p/ubuntu_lib/git/raw/master/jdk/apache-maven-3.5.0-bin.tar.gz
#extract maven
tar -xvf apache-maven-3.5.0-bin.tar.gz -C /usr/local/maven3
#set environment
export M2_HOME="/usr/local/maven3/apache-maven-3.5.0"
if ! grep M2_HOME="/usr/local/maven3/apache-maven-3.5.0" /etc/profile
then
echo "M2_HOME=/usr/local/maven3/apache-maven-3.5.0" | sudo tee -a /etc/profile
echo "export M2_HOME" | sudo tee -a /etc/profile
echo "PATH=${M2_HOME}/bin:$PATH" | sudo tee -a /etc/profile
echo "export PATH" | sudo tee -a /etc/profile
fi
#update profile
#su jamesz2011
source /etc/profile
echo "------------------end to install maven----------------------"
sudo update-alternatives --install /usr/bin/java java /usr/local/java/jdk1.8.0_121/bin/java 300
sudo update-alternatives --install /usr/bin/javac javac /usr/local/java/jdk1.8.0_121/bin/javac 300
sudo update-alternatives --install /usr/bin/mvn mvn /usr/local/maven3/apache-maven-3.5.0/bin/mvn 400
sudo update-alternatives --config java
sudo update-alternatives --config javac
echo "------------------------------------------------------------"
echo "------------------install jdk_maven is over-----------------"
2.install_maven.sh文件地址:
3.用法:
wget https://coding.net/u/jamesz2011/p/ubuntu_lib/git/raw/master/jdk/install_maven.sh
sudo chmod a+x/install_maven.sh
sudo source/install_maven.sh
4.验证是否安装成功:
输入 mvn -versoin [若出现版本号,则安装成功]